What is V V Food & Beverage Co Short-Term Debt?

V V Food & Beverage Co SHSE:600300 -2.13% 66 Short-Term Debt is ¥134 Mil as of Jun. 2026. GuruFocus rates SHSE:600300 with a GF Score™ of 66/100 and a GF Value™ of ¥3.03 (Fairly Valued). The stock has 2 warning signs investors should review.

V V Food & Beverage Co's Short-Term Debt for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 was ¥134 Mil.

V V Food & Beverage Co's quarterly Short-Term Debt declined from Dec. 2025 (¥269 Mil) to Mar. 2026 (¥141 Mil) and declined from Mar. 2026 (¥141 Mil) to Jun. 2026 (¥134 Mil).

V V Food & Beverage Co's annual Short-Term Debt increased from Dec. 2023 (¥135 Mil) to Dec. 2024 (¥195 Mil) and increased from Dec. 2024 (¥195 Mil) to Dec. 2025 (¥269 Mil).


V V Food & Beverage Co Short-Term Debt Explanation

Short-Term Debt represents the total amount of Long-Term Debt such as bank loans and commercial paper, which is due within one year.

V V Food & Beverage Co Business Description

Address No. 300 Weiwei Avenue, Jiangsu Province, Xuzhou, CHN, 221111
V V Food & Beverage Co Ltd is engaged the in various businesses, including agricultural resources, food and beverage, grain and oil processing, liquor, and tea. The products are offered under various brands such as VV, Tianshan Snow, SOYJOY, Liuchaosong, Zhijiang, and Guizhouchun.
